AI-помощник GitHub: автоматизация PR, CI/CD, issues и releases

GitHub workflow: AI ревьюит PR, merge'ит, создаёт releases, закрывает issues

Агент управляет GitHub workflows: ревьюит PR (код-качество, тесты), merge'ит когда ок, создаёт release notes, публикует новые версии, закрывает issues автоматически. Может также: проверить что CI pass'ит, управлять branch protection rules, архивировать старые branches. От 1 490 ₽/мес.

366k+⭐ OpenClaw на GitHub
<5минут до запуска

Звучит знакомо?

Что съедает ваше время

PR процесс медленный: нужно manually merge, потом создать release, потом обновить changelog, много manual steps

CI интеграция слабая: ПР merge'ится хотя CI не pass, потом product broken

Issues задумываются и заброшены: нет систематического tracking completed work

Release notes вручную: version bump, changelog update, tag creation, release description — всё руками, риск consistency

Возможности

Что умеет ваш AI-агент

Автоматический PR review

Агент ловит новый PR: читает изменения, проверяет: title followed convention, description present, tests added, no obvious bugs. Может одобрить (approve) или запросить changes.

Автоматический merge когда готово

Когда все checks pass'ят (CI green, code review ok, no conflicts) → агент может merge PR автоматически. Опционально: squash/rebase/merge (configurable per branch).

Автоматическое создание releases

После merge'а на main агент может автоматически: bump version (semver: major/minor/patch), create git tag, публикует release на GitHub с auto-generated release notes (based on commits + pull requests).

管理 branches и cleanup

Агент может: удалить merged branches автоматически, архивировать old branches, enforce branch protection rules (require PR reviews, require CI pass), check staleness (1+ недель без updates → предложить close).

Автозакрытие issues

Когда PR merge'ится и связана с issue (упоминание в PR body) → агент может автоматически close issue. Или если issue tagged 'completed' → archive из backlog.

Работает с вашими инструментами

GitHub
GitHub Actions
Slack
Linear
Jira
NPM Registry
Как это работает

Запустите за несколько шагов

1

PR создан

Developer создаёт PR на main (или любой watched branch). Заполняет title, description, ссылается на issue если есть (e.g. 'Closes #123'). Агент видит PR сразу.

2

Автоматический review

Агент анализирует PR: проверяет title format, description quality, изменения (есть ли тесты, не слишком большой), CI status. Может approve или request changes с комментарием.

3

CI и human review

GitHub Actions запускают тесты (автоматически). Human code reviewer (or agent if configured) читают, комментируют. Когда всё ок: approvals + CI green.

4

Автоматический merge

Когда все conditions ready (approvals, CI green, no conflicts) → агент merge'ит PR (squash or regular, configurable). Может also delete branch после merge'а автоматически.

5

Release и issue closure

Если commit попал на main → агент может: создать release (bump version, tag, release notes), publish на NPM/registry, автозакрыть linked issues. Notифицирует в Slack об обновлении.

FAQ

Часто задаваемые вопросы

Опционально, но рисковано. Для simple changes (docs, CI config) — может. Для code changes — лучше требовать human approval. Configurable per branch: main требует human, develop можно auto-approve если CI pass.

Хотите OpenClaw — но без DevOps?

OpenKlo — managed-хостинг оригинального OpenClaw. Тот же агент, но в браузере за 3 минуты.

Оплата в рублях · Все топовые модели включены · Меняйте тариф в любой момент